Quad Indicted crossed an important line today

Certain speech is not protected by the First Amendment. Incitement to imminent lawless action, harassment, true threats, defamation, obscenity, and fighting words are not protected speech. And when QI made public statements directing his minions to “go after” AG James QI crossed that line.

The NY Judge imposed a gag order on him for posting a defamatory picture and untrue statements about the Judge’s aide.

In a few days, QI must come before the DC Federal Judge for his insurrection trial and she may very well order him to show cause why his bail shouldn’t be revoked. He has put himself squarely on the path to pre trial detention.
